Head of Apprenticeship Quality & Ofsted Institutional Nominee

Ready to lead apprenticeship quality at institutional level and shape an outstanding experience for apprentices, employers and academic teams?

The University of Salford is looking for an experienced apprenticeship quality leader to join us as Head of Apprenticeship Quality & Ofsted Institutional Nominee. This high-profile role will provide strategic leadership for quality assurance, continuous improvement, regulatory readiness and Ofsted inspection activity.

Building on our Ofsted Good apprenticeship provision, you will strengthen institutional assurance and drive enhancement across a portfolio spanning sectors including construction, engineering, health, science and public services.

In this role, you will act as the University’s named Ofsted Institutional Nominee and senior inspection contact, leading apprenticeship quality assurance, self-assessment, improvement planning and inspection readiness. You will advise senior leaders, governance committees, Schools and Professional Services on quality, performance and regulatory risk, using evidence-led improvement to build confidence, consistency and readiness across the institution.

You will bring credibility in apprenticeship quality, external inspection or regulatory assurance, with the confidence to operate at senior level. You will be able to translate complex requirements into clear action, influence diverse stakeholders and use evidence to drive meaningful improvement.
